One of the biggest trends we spotted in both the beauty and foods sections, was definitely the omnipresence of coconut. Whether it was praised for its many nourishing characteristics in personal care products or added to foods for its taste and dietary superpowers, coconut seems to deliver many answers about beauty and lifestyle questions this year.
